       Change return values of functions for consistency
       
       By default, all functions will return 0 on success, and a negative value
       on failure.
       
       Functions checking a window state (functions named `wm_is_*`) will
       return 1 on success and 0 on failure. This is for semantic reasons:
       
               if (wm_is_mapped(wid))
                       // do stuff
       
       Some functions have a return value that is not representative of the
       success of said function, and instead will return an item specific to
       ttheir usage.
